Billing rule templates (config-file mode).
|
||
|
|
|
||
|
|
Goal:
|
||
|
|
- Developers define billing rules in code as templates ("模式一/二/三/四/五 ...").
|
||
|
|
- Adding a new billing template should only require adding a new `*.py` file under
|
||
|
|
`src.services.billing.rule_defs` (no DB / no UI).
|
||
|
|
|
||
|
|
How it works:
|
||
|
|
- Each module under `rule_defs/` exports `TEMPLATES: list[CodeBillingRuleTemplate]`.
|
||
|
|
- We dynamically discover all templates at runtime and pick the best one by:
|
||
|
|
- task_type match
|
||
|
|
- optional match(ctx) predicate
|
||
|
|
- highest priority wins
|
||
|
|
"""
